Python在数据分析中的重要性及应用

简介: 【2月更文挑战第9天】随着大数据时代的到来,数据分析在各个领域中扮演着至关重要的角色。而Python作为一种简单易学、功能强大的编程语言,正日益成为数据科学家和分析师们的首选工具。本文将探讨Python在数据分析领域中的重要性,并介绍其在数据处理、可视化和机器学习等方面的应用。

引言
在当今信息爆炸的时代,数据已经成为了各行各业中不可或缺的资源。通过对海量数据进行分析,我们可以挖掘出有价值的信息,为决策提供科学依据。而Python作为一种高效、灵活的编程语言,被广泛应用于数据分析领域。
数据处理
数据分析的第一步是数据处理,而Python提供了丰富的库和工具,能够方便地进行数据的读取、清洗和转换。例如,Pandas库提供了强大的数据结构和数据分析工具,可以快速、高效地处理和操作数据。同时,Numpy库提供了高性能的数值计算功能,为数据处理提供了强大的支持。
数据可视化
数据可视化是数据分析中不可或缺的一环,它能够将复杂的数据转化为直观的图形展示,帮助我们更好地理解数据。Python的Matplotlib和Seaborn库提供了丰富的绘图功能,可以绘制各种类型的图表,如折线图、散点图、直方图等。此外,Plotly库还可以创建交互式的可视化图表,使得数据探索更加灵活和便捷。
机器学习
机器学习是数据分析中的热门领域,Python凭借其丰富的机器学习库和框架,成为了数据科学家们的首选工具。例如,Scikit-learn库提供了常用的机器学习算法和工具,使得模型的训练和评估变得简单易行。而TensorFlow和PyTorch等深度学习框架,则为复杂的神经网络模型提供了强大的支持。
应用案例
Python在数据分析中的应用案例举不胜举。例如,在金融领域,通过Python可以对大量的交易数据进行分析和建模,帮助投资者制定更合理的投资策略。在市场营销领域,Python可以通过对用户数据的分析,为企业提供个性化的推荐和营销方案。在医疗领域,Python可以通过分析大量的病历数据,辅助医生进行疾病诊断和治疗方案的制定。
结论
Python作为一种简单易学、功能强大的编程语言,在数据分析领域中发挥着重要的作用。它提供了丰富的库和工具,使得数据处理、可视化和机器学习变得更加高效和便捷。随着数据分析的广泛应用,Python将继续在各个领域中扮演重要的角色,为我们带来更多的机遇和挑战。

相关文章
|
1月前
|
人工智能 自然语言处理 数据挖掘
云上玩转Qwen3系列之三:PAI-LangStudio x Hologres构建ChatBI数据分析Agent应用
PAI-LangStudio 和 Qwen3 构建基于 MCP 协议的 Hologres ChatBI 智能 Agent 应用,通过将 Agent、MCP Server 等技术和阿里最新的推理模型 Qwen3 编排在一个应用流中,为大模型提供了 MCP+OLAP 的智能数据分析能力,使用自然语言即可实现 OLAP 数据分析的查询效果,减少了幻觉。开发者可以基于该模板进行灵活扩展和二次开发,以满足特定场景的需求。
|
2月前
|
机器学习/深度学习 数据可视化 算法
Python数值方法在工程和科学问题解决中的应用
本文探讨了Python数值方法在工程和科学领域的广泛应用。首先介绍了数值计算的基本概念及Python的优势,如易学易用、丰富的库支持和跨平台性。接着分析了Python在有限元分析、信号处理、优化问题求解和控制系统设计等工程问题中的应用,以及在数据分析、机器学习、模拟建模和深度学习等科学问题中的实践。通过具体案例,展示了Python解决实际问题的能力,最后总结展望了Python在未来工程和科学研究中的发展潜力。
|
25天前
|
存储 监控 算法
企业数据泄露风险防控视域下 Python 布隆过滤器算法的应用研究 —— 怎样防止员工私下接单,监控为例
本文探讨了布隆过滤器在企业员工行为监控中的应用。布隆过滤器是一种高效概率数据结构,具有空间复杂度低、查询速度快的特点,适用于大规模数据过滤场景。文章分析了其在网络访问监控和通讯内容筛查中的实践价值,并通过Python实现示例展示其技术优势。同时,文中指出布隆过滤器存在误判风险,需在准确性和资源消耗间权衡。最后强调构建多维度监控体系的重要性,结合技术与管理手段保障企业运营安全。
48 10
|
23天前
|
机器学习/深度学习 数据采集 数据可视化
Python数据分析,别再死磕Excel了!
Python数据分析,别再死磕Excel了!
68 2
|
22天前
|
机器学习/深度学习 算法 测试技术
图神经网络在信息检索重排序中的应用:原理、架构与Python代码解析
本文探讨了基于图的重排序方法在信息检索领域的应用与前景。传统两阶段检索架构中,初始检索速度快但结果可能含噪声,重排序阶段通过强大语言模型提升精度,但仍面临复杂需求挑战
56 0
图神经网络在信息检索重排序中的应用:原理、架构与Python代码解析
|
1月前
|
存储 机器学习/深度学习 算法
论上网限制软件中 Python 动态衰减权重算法于行为管控领域的创新性应用
在网络安全与行为管理的学术语境中,上网限制软件面临着精准识别并管控用户不合规网络请求的复杂任务。传统的基于静态规则库或固定阈值的策略,在实践中暴露出较高的误判率与较差的动态适应性。本研究引入一种基于 “动态衰减权重算法” 的优化策略,融合时间序列分析与权重衰减机制,旨在显著提升上网限制软件的实时决策效能。
43 2
|
2月前
|
Python
Python中Cp、Cpk、Pp、Ppk的计算与应用
总的来说,Cp、Cpk、Pp、Ppk是衡量过程能力的重要工具,它们可以帮助我们了解和改进生产过程,提高产品质量。
145 13
|
2月前
|
数据采集 XML 存储
Headers池技术在Python爬虫反反爬中的应用
Headers池技术在Python爬虫反反爬中的应用
|
3月前
|
机器学习/深度学习 存储 设计模式
Python 高级编程与实战:深入理解性能优化与调试技巧
本文深入探讨了Python的性能优化与调试技巧,涵盖profiling、caching、Cython等优化工具,以及pdb、logging、assert等调试方法。通过实战项目,如优化斐波那契数列计算和调试Web应用,帮助读者掌握这些技术,提升编程效率。附有进一步学习资源,助力读者深入学习。
|
1月前
|
数据采集 安全 BI
用Python编程基础提升工作效率
一、文件处理整明白了,少加两小时班 (敲暖气管子)领导让整理100个Excel表?手都干抽筋儿了?Python就跟铲雪车似的,哗哗给你整利索!
70 11

推荐镜像

更多